Inland Real Estate is a real estate investment trust that owns, operates and develops (directly or through its unconsolidated entities) open-air neighborhood, community and power shopping centers and single tenant retail properties located throughout the Central and Southeastern U.S. Through wholly-owned subsidiaries, Co. manages all properties it owns interests in and properties for certain third parties and related parties. At Dec 31 2014, Co. owned interests in 159 investment properties, including those owned through its unconsolidated joint ventures, comprised of: 48 neighborhood retail centers; 32 community centers; 40 power centers; one lifestyle center; and 38 single-user properties.
